The KENNAMETAL 1953343 is an indexable internal grooving toolholder designed for precision groove cutting on CNC lathes and turning centers. Built to the A-A4E toolholder style, it accepts A4..04.. series inserts and features a clamp-style insert holding method for rigid, repeatable edge positioning. The toolholder includes through-coolant capability, directing fluid directly to the cutting zone to extend insert life and improve chip evacuation in deep internal groove applications. With a maximum depth of cut of 0.394 inches and a minimum groove width of 0.157 inches, this holder is suited for fine-tolerance internal grooving work performed by machinists and CNC operators in production and job-shop environments.
This toolholder is configured for right-hand cutting and is intended for internal grooving operations where the minimum hole diameter is 1.26 inches. The overall length of 8.02 inches and a back-of-bar to cutting edge distance of 0.669 inches make it compatible with standard gang-tooled or turret-mounted setups. Maximum bore depth reaches 1.97 inches, supporting a range of internal groove depths on steel, alloy, and similar machinable workpiece materials. It is a multi-use tool suitable for recurring production runs or one-off turning operations requiring consistent groove geometry.
Compatible with A4..04.. series inserts. Insert seat size is 4. Minimum hole diameter for use is 1.26 inches. Designed as an OEM-style internal grooving toolholder for use on CNC lathes and turning centers configured for right-hand internal grooving operations.
Installation should be performed by a qualified machinist or CNC setup technician. Confirm the machine spindle and turret are fully powered down and locked out before mounting or adjusting the toolholder. Verify coolant line connections are secure before enabling through-coolant flow. Follow the machine tool manufacturer guidelines and applicable shop safety procedures when setting tool offsets and runout.
